What's in Bay Area Tap Water?

Bay Area water quality varies dramatically depending on where you live. San Francisco gets pristine Hetch Hetchy water from Yosemite. The East Bay draws from Pardee Reservoir. South Bay relies on a mix of imported and local groundwater. Each utility treats its water differently, resulting in very different experiences at the tap.

Key ContaminantBay Area LevelContext
Hardness1–15 GPG"Soft to Hard"; varies dramatically by municipality
ChloraminePresentSFPUC, EBMUD, and others use chloramine for disinfection
PFASNon-detectEmerging contaminant of concern; monitoring ongoing
TDS (Total Dissolved Solids)~50–180 mg/LLow (SFPUC) to moderate (groundwater-dependent areas)
Lead (at tap)Non-detectFrom aging service lines, not source water

Water Softener Restrictions in the Bay Area & California

Traditional water softeners discharge salt brine into municipal wastewater systems. That brine is expensive and difficult to remove during treatment, and it can damage the environment when it reaches the Bay, rivers, and groundwater. In a region as environmentally conscious as the Bay Area, this matters.

California context:

The Santa Clara Valley Water District has specifically addressed salt-based softener discharge as part of its water quality protection programs. Multiple California cities — including Santa Clarita, Fillmore, and communities in San Bernardino County — have already restricted or banned salt-based softeners. The Bay Area's proximity to sensitive ecosystems including the San Francisco Bay makes brine discharge an especially scrutinized issue. Choosing a salt-free system means compliance with current and future regulations across all Bay Area municipalities.
